The Rise of Online Driving License Services: Navigating the New Age of Licensing
In an age where benefit reigns supreme, the process of getting a driving license has developed considerably. With the advent of innovation and digital services, numerous countries and states have started using online platforms for individuals to obtain, restore, or update their driving licenses. This thorough guide explores the process of getting a driving license online, discusses its advantages and disadvantages, and offers responses to regularly asked concerns.
Understanding Online Driving License Services
The idea of online driving license services allows individuals to handle different elements of their driving requirements by means of the web. This includes the following functions:

Although the particular treatments may vary by jurisdiction, the basic actions to obtaining a driving license online normally consist of:

Is it possible to obtain a driving license online in any state?
Not every state or nation offers online applications for driving licenses. It is necessary to check with the local DMV or relevant authority to confirm available services.
2. What documents do I need to use online for a driving license?
Typical files required might include proof of identity (like a passport or birth certificate), proof of residency (such as energy bills), and a social security number. Check the particular requirements for your state or area.
3. Can I take the driving test online?
In lots of jurisdictions, the written part of the driving test can be taken online, however the useful driving test typically needs an in-person assessment at a designated area.
4. How can I guarantee the online service is safe?
Guarantee that you are on a genuine government site (usually ending in ". gov"). Look for SSL certificates suggested by "https://" in the URL and a padlock sign next to the web page address before getting in any individual info.
5. What if I deal with problems during the online application procedure?
Most official sites have customer care lines or assist desks to resolve issues you might encounter. Inspect for contact info on the website.
